Documentation ¶
Overview ¶
Cisco-IOS-XR-rsi-agent-oper:rsi-agent/nodes/node/vrfdb/vrf-names/vrf-name
Index ¶
- type RsiAgentTblRef
- func (*RsiAgentTblRef) Descriptor() ([]byte, []int)
- func (m *RsiAgentTblRef) GetAfi() string
- func (m *RsiAgentTblRef) GetSafi() string
- func (m *RsiAgentTblRef) GetTblName() string
- func (m *RsiAgentTblRef) GetVrfTblIdx() uint32
- func (*RsiAgentTblRef) ProtoMessage()
- func (m *RsiAgentTblRef) Reset()
- func (m *RsiAgentTblRef) String() string
- func (m *RsiAgentTblRef) XXX_DiscardUnknown()
- func (m *RsiAgentTblRef)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)
- func (m *RsiAgentTblRef) XXX_Merge(src proto.Message)
- func (m *RsiAgentTblRef) XXX_Size() int
- func (m *RsiAgentTblRef) XXX_Unmarshal(b []byte) error
- type RsiAgentVrf
- func (*RsiAgentVrf) Descriptor() ([]byte, []int)
- func (m *RsiAgentVrf) GetFallbackVrfName() string
- func (m *RsiAgentVrf) GetIntfCntLocal() uint32
- func (m *RsiAgentVrf) GetIntfCountGlobal() int32
- func (m *RsiAgentVrf) GetIntfCountLocal() int32
- func (m *RsiAgentVrf) GetNumFwdRefTbls() int32
- func (m *RsiAgentVrf) GetNumRealTbls() int32
- func (m *RsiAgentVrf) GetParentvrfCnt() uint32
- func (m *RsiAgentVrf) GetRefcount() int32
- func (m *RsiAgentVrf) GetSubmodeFlag() uint32
- func (m *RsiAgentVrf) GetTableArray() []*RsiAgentTblRef
- func (m *RsiAgentVrf) GetTblByVrfNameRegs() int32
- func (m *RsiAgentVrf) GetTblByVrfRegs() int32
- func (m *RsiAgentVrf) GetVpnId() *RsiVpnidT
- func (m *RsiAgentVrf) GetVrId() uint32
- func (m *RsiAgentVrf) GetVrName() string
- func (m *RsiAgentVrf) GetVrfByVrfIdRegs() int32
- func (m *RsiAgentVrf) GetVrfByVrfNameRegs() int32
- func (m *RsiAgentVrf) GetVrfFlags() uint32
- func (m *RsiAgentVrf) GetVrfGroups() uint32
- func (m *RsiAgentVrf) GetVrfId() uint32
- func (m *RsiAgentVrf) GetVrfName() string
- func (*RsiAgentVrf) ProtoMessage()
- func (m *RsiAgentVrf) Reset()
- func (m *RsiAgentVrf) String() string
- func (m *RsiAgentVrf) XXX_DiscardUnknown()
- func (m *RsiAgentVrf)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)
- func (m *RsiAgentVrf) XXX_Merge(src proto.Message)
- func (m *RsiAgentVrf) XXX_Size() int
- func (m *RsiAgentVrf) XXX_Unmarshal(b []byte) error
- type RsiAgentVrf_KEYS
- func (*RsiAgentVrf_KEYS) Descriptor() ([]byte, []int)
- func (m *RsiAgentVrf_KEYS) GetName() string
- func (m *RsiAgentVrf_KEYS) GetNodeName() string
- func (*RsiAgentVrf_KEYS) ProtoMessage()
- func (m *RsiAgentVrf_KEYS) Reset()
- func (m *RsiAgentVrf_KEYS) String() string
- func (m *RsiAgentVrf_KEYS) XXX_DiscardUnknown()
- func (m *RsiAgentVrf_KEYS)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)
- func (m *RsiAgentVrf_KEYS) XXX_Merge(src proto.Message)
- func (m *RsiAgentVrf_KEYS) XXX_Size() int
- func (m *RsiAgentVrf_KEYS) XXX_Unmarshal(b []byte) error
- type RsiVpnidT
- func (*RsiVpnidT) Descriptor() ([]byte, []int)
- func (m *RsiVpnidT) GetIndex() uint32
- func (m *RsiVpnidT) GetOui() uint32
- func (*RsiVpnidT) ProtoMessage()
- func (m *RsiVpnidT) Reset()
- func (m *RsiVpnidT) String() string
- func (m *RsiVpnidT) XXX_DiscardUnknown()
- func (m *RsiVpnidT)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)
- func (m *RsiVpnidT) XXX_Merge(src proto.Message)
- func (m *RsiVpnidT) XXX_Size() int
- func (m *RsiVpnidT) XXX_Unmarshal(b []byte) error
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type RsiAgentTblRef ¶
type RsiAgentTblRef struct { VrfTblIdx uint32 `protobuf:"varint,1,opt,name=vrf_tbl_idx,json=vrfTblIdx,proto3" json:"vrf_tbl_idx,omitempty"` Afi string `protobuf:"bytes,2,opt,name=afi,proto3" json:"afi,omitempty"` Safi string `protobuf:"bytes,3,opt,name=safi,proto3" json:"safi,omitempty"` TblName string `protobuf:"bytes,4,opt,name=tbl_name,json=tblName,proto3" json:"tbl_name,omitempty"` XXX_NoUnkeyedLiteral struct{} `json:"-"` XXX_unrecognized []byte `json:"-"` XXX_sizecache int32 `json:"-"` }
func (*RsiAgentTblRef) Descriptor ¶
func (*RsiAgentTblRef) Descriptor() ([]byte, []int)
func (*RsiAgentTblRef) GetAfi ¶
func (m *RsiAgentTblRef) GetAfi() string
func (*RsiAgentTblRef) GetSafi ¶
func (m *RsiAgentTblRef) GetSafi() string
func (*RsiAgentTblRef) GetTblName ¶
func (m *RsiAgentTblRef) GetTblName() string
func (*RsiAgentTblRef) GetVrfTblIdx ¶
func (m *RsiAgentTblRef) GetVrfTblIdx() uint32
func (*RsiAgentTblRef) ProtoMessage ¶
func (*RsiAgentTblRef) ProtoMessage()
func (*RsiAgentTblRef) Reset ¶
func (m *RsiAgentTblRef) Reset()
func (*RsiAgentTblRef) String ¶
func (m *RsiAgentTblRef) String() string
func (*RsiAgentTblRef) XXX_DiscardUnknown ¶
func (m *RsiAgentTblRef) XXX_DiscardUnknown()
func (*RsiAgentTblRef) XXX_Marshal ¶
func (m *RsiAgentTblRef)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)
func (*RsiAgentTblRef) XXX_Merge ¶
func (m *RsiAgentTblRef) XXX_Merge(src proto.Message)
func (*RsiAgentTblRef) XXX_Size ¶
func (m *RsiAgentTblRef) XXX_Size() int
func (*RsiAgentTblRef) XXX_Unmarshal ¶
func (m *RsiAgentTblRef) XXX_Unmarshal(b []byte) error
type RsiAgentVrf ¶
type RsiAgentVrf struct { VrfName string `protobuf:"bytes,50,opt,name=vrf_name,json=vrfName,proto3" json:"vrf_name,omitempty"` VrfId uint32 `protobuf:"varint,51,opt,name=vrf_id,json=vrfId,proto3" json:"vrf_id,omitempty"` VrId uint32 `protobuf:"varint,52,opt,name=vr_id,json=vrId,proto3" json:"vr_id,omitempty"` VpnId *RsiVpnidT `protobuf:"bytes,53,opt,name=vpn_id,json=vpnId,proto3" json:"vpn_id,omitempty"` SubmodeFlag uint32 `protobuf:"varint,54,opt,name=submode_flag,json=submodeFlag,proto3" json:"submode_flag,omitempty"` FallbackVrfName string `protobuf:"bytes,55,opt,name=fallback_vrf_name,json=fallbackVrfName,proto3" json:"fallback_vrf_name,omitempty"` VrName string `protobuf:"bytes,56,opt,name=vr_name,json=vrName,proto3" json:"vr_name,omitempty"` Refcount int32 `protobuf:"zigzag32,57,opt,name=refcount,proto3" json:"refcount,omitempty"` IntfCountLocal int32 `protobuf:"zigzag32,58,opt,name=intf_count_local,json=intfCountLocal,proto3" json:"intf_count_local,omitempty"` IntfCountGlobal int32 `protobuf:"zigzag32,59,opt,name=intf_count_global,json=intfCountGlobal,proto3" json:"intf_count_global,omitempty"` NumRealTbls int32 `protobuf:"zigzag32,60,opt,name=num_real_tbls,json=numRealTbls,proto3" json:"num_real_tbls,omitempty"` NumFwdRefTbls int32 `protobuf:"zigzag32,61,opt,name=num_fwd_ref_tbls,json=numFwdRefTbls,proto3" json:"num_fwd_ref_tbls,omitempty"` VrfByVrfIdRegs int32 `protobuf:"zigzag32,62,opt,name=vrf_by_vrf_id_regs,json=vrfByVrfIdRegs,proto3" json:"vrf_by_vrf_id_regs,omitempty"` VrfByVrfNameRegs int32 `protobuf:"zigzag32,63,opt,name=vrf_by_vrf_name_regs,json=vrfByVrfNameRegs,proto3" json:"vrf_by_vrf_name_regs,omitempty"` TblByVrfRegs int32 `protobuf:"zigzag32,64,opt,name=tbl_by_vrf_regs,json=tblByVrfRegs,proto3" json:"tbl_by_vrf_regs,omitempty"` TblByVrfNameRegs int32 `protobuf:"zigzag32,65,opt,name=tbl_by_vrf_name_regs,json=tblByVrfNameRegs,proto3" json:"tbl_by_vrf_name_regs,omitempty"` TableArray []*RsiAgentTblRef `protobuf:"bytes,66,rep,name=table_array,json=tableArray,proto3" json:"table_array,omitempty"` VrfFlags uint32 `protobuf:"varint,67,opt,name=vrf_flags,json=vrfFlags,proto3" json:"vrf_flags,omitempty"` IntfCntLocal uint32 `protobuf:"varint,68,opt,name=intf_cnt_local,json=intfCntLocal,proto3" json:"intf_cnt_local,omitempty"` VrfGroups uint32 `protobuf:"varint,69,opt,name=vrf_groups,json=vrfGroups,proto3" json:"vrf_groups,omitempty"` ParentvrfCnt uint32 `protobuf:"varint,70,opt,name=parentvrf_cnt,json=parentvrfCnt,proto3" json:"parentvrf_cnt,omitempty"` XXX_NoUnkeyedLiteral struct{} `json:"-"` XXX_unrecognized []byte `json:"-"` XXX_sizecache int32 `json:"-"` }
func (*RsiAgentVrf) Descriptor ¶
func (*RsiAgentVrf) Descriptor() ([]byte, []int)
func (*RsiAgentVrf) GetFallbackVrfName ¶
func (m *RsiAgentVrf) GetFallbackVrfName() string
func (*RsiAgentVrf) GetIntfCntLocal ¶
func (m *RsiAgentVrf) GetIntfCntLocal() uint32
func (*RsiAgentVrf) GetIntfCountGlobal ¶
func (m *RsiAgentVrf) GetIntfCountGlobal() int32
func (*RsiAgentVrf) GetIntfCountLocal ¶
func (m *RsiAgentVrf) GetIntfCountLocal() int32
func (*RsiAgentVrf) GetNumFwdRefTbls ¶
func (m *RsiAgentVrf) GetNumFwdRefTbls() int32
func (*RsiAgentVrf) GetNumRealTbls ¶
func (m *RsiAgentVrf) GetNumRealTbls() int32
func (*RsiAgentVrf) GetParentvrfCnt ¶
func (m *RsiAgentVrf) GetParentvrfCnt() uint32
func (*RsiAgentVrf) GetRefcount ¶
func (m *RsiAgentVrf) GetRefcount() int32
func (*RsiAgentVrf) GetSubmodeFlag ¶
func (m *RsiAgentVrf) GetSubmodeFlag() uint32
func (*RsiAgentVrf) GetTableArray ¶
func (m *RsiAgentVrf) GetTableArray() []*RsiAgentTblRef
func (*RsiAgentVrf) GetTblByVrfNameRegs ¶
func (m *RsiAgentVrf) GetTblByVrfNameRegs() int32
func (*RsiAgentVrf) GetTblByVrfRegs ¶
func (m *RsiAgentVrf) GetTblByVrfRegs() int32
func (*RsiAgentVrf) GetVpnId ¶
func (m *RsiAgentVrf) GetVpnId() *RsiVpnidT
func (*RsiAgentVrf) GetVrId ¶
func (m *RsiAgentVrf) GetVrId() uint32
func (*RsiAgentVrf) GetVrName ¶
func (m *RsiAgentVrf) GetVrName() string
func (*RsiAgentVrf) GetVrfByVrfIdRegs ¶
func (m *RsiAgentVrf) GetVrfByVrfIdRegs() int32
func (*RsiAgentVrf) GetVrfByVrfNameRegs ¶
func (m *RsiAgentVrf) GetVrfByVrfNameRegs() int32
func (*RsiAgentVrf) GetVrfFlags ¶
func (m *RsiAgentVrf) GetVrfFlags() uint32
func (*RsiAgentVrf) GetVrfGroups ¶
func (m *RsiAgentVrf) GetVrfGroups() uint32
func (*RsiAgentVrf) GetVrfId ¶
func (m *RsiAgentVrf) GetVrfId() uint32
func (*RsiAgentVrf) GetVrfName ¶
func (m *RsiAgentVrf) GetVrfName() string
func (*RsiAgentVrf) ProtoMessage ¶
func (*RsiAgentVrf) ProtoMessage()
func (*RsiAgentVrf) Reset ¶
func (m *RsiAgentVrf) Reset()
func (*RsiAgentVrf) String ¶
func (m *RsiAgentVrf) String() string
func (*RsiAgentVrf) XXX_DiscardUnknown ¶
func (m *RsiAgentVrf) XXX_DiscardUnknown()
func (*RsiAgentVrf) XXX_Marshal ¶
func (m *RsiAgentVrf)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)
func (*RsiAgentVrf) XXX_Merge ¶
func (m *RsiAgentVrf) XXX_Merge(src proto.Message)
func (*RsiAgentVrf) XXX_Size ¶
func (m *RsiAgentVrf) XXX_Size() int
func (*RsiAgentVrf) XXX_Unmarshal ¶
func (m *RsiAgentVrf) XXX_Unmarshal(b []byte) error
type RsiAgentVrf_KEYS ¶
type RsiAgentVrf_KEYS struct { NodeName string `protobuf:"bytes,1,opt,name=node_name,json=nodeName,proto3" json:"node_name,omitempty"` Name string `protobuf:"bytes,2,opt,name=name,proto3" json:"name,omitempty"` XXX_NoUnkeyedLiteral struct{} `json:"-"` XXX_unrecognized []byte `json:"-"` XXX_sizecache int32 `json:"-"` }
func (*RsiAgentVrf_KEYS) Descriptor ¶
func (*RsiAgentVrf_KEYS) Descriptor() ([]byte, []int)
func (*RsiAgentVrf_KEYS) GetName ¶
func (m *RsiAgentVrf_KEYS) GetName() string
func (*RsiAgentVrf_KEYS) GetNodeName ¶
func (m *RsiAgentVrf_KEYS) GetNodeName() string
func (*RsiAgentVrf_KEYS) ProtoMessage ¶
func (*RsiAgentVrf_KEYS) ProtoMessage()
func (*RsiAgentVrf_KEYS) Reset ¶
func (m *RsiAgentVrf_KEYS) Reset()
func (*RsiAgentVrf_KEYS) String ¶
func (m *RsiAgentVrf_KEYS) String() string
func (*RsiAgentVrf_KEYS) XXX_DiscardUnknown ¶
func (m *RsiAgentVrf_KEYS) XXX_DiscardUnknown()
func (*RsiAgentVrf_KEYS) XXX_Marshal ¶
func (m *RsiAgentVrf_KEYS) XXX_Marshal(b []byte, deterministic bool) ([]byte, error)
func (*RsiAgentVrf_KEYS) XXX_Merge ¶
func (m *RsiAgentVrf_KEYS) XXX_Merge(src proto.Message)
func (*RsiAgentVrf_KEYS) XXX_Size ¶
func (m *RsiAgentVrf_KEYS) XXX_Size() int
func (*RsiAgentVrf_KEYS) XXX_Unmarshal ¶
func (m *RsiAgentVrf_KEYS) XXX_Unmarshal(b []byte) error
type RsiVpnidT ¶
type RsiVpnidT struct { Oui uint32 `protobuf:"varint,1,opt,name=oui,proto3" json:"oui,omitempty"` Index uint32 `protobuf:"varint,2,opt,name=index,proto3" json:"index,omitempty"` XXX_NoUnkeyedLiteral struct{} `json:"-"` XXX_unrecognized []byte `json:"-"` XXX_sizecache int32 `json:"-"` }
func (*RsiVpnidT) Descriptor ¶
func (*RsiVpnidT) ProtoMessage ¶
func (*RsiVpnidT) ProtoMessage()
func (*RsiVpnidT) XXX_DiscardUnknown ¶
func (m *RsiVpnidT) XXX_DiscardUnknown()
func (*RsiVpnidT) XXX_Marshal ¶
func (*RsiVpnidT) XXX_Unmarshal ¶
Click to show internal directories.
Click to hide internal directories.